AaronJB Posted April 21, 2009 Report Posted April 21, 2009 Midway is fine from a hotel standpoint - there are a fair amount of hotels in the area (although they seem rather expensive at times.) Midway is not fine from a "things to do" standpoint - there's really not much around Midway aside from Midway and it's not the best area. For an area with both things to do and a great selection of hotels, I'd recommend Oak Brook/Downers Grove, two SW suburbs.There are very few hotels *right* outside of Chicago - you have to go a ways outside the city before you start seeing more hotels again.
